Output 344eb3efd005132a610f580cb27a624e8d591dc90d12e3acfdd2f15e34333821:29

value
1549636
script pubkey
OP_0 OP_PUSHBYTES_20 0ebd8c7898f54265397075e15da12d32aeb6a16a
address
bc1qp67cc7yc74px2wtswhs4mgfdx2htdgt22g4y88
transaction
344eb3efd005132a610f580cb27a624e8d591dc90d12e3acfdd2f15e34333821
spent
true